Step-by-Step Guide
Defrosting an English muffin is a simple process that can be done in just a few minutes. Here’s how to do it:
1. Remove the English muffin from the freezer and place it on a plate or cutting board.
2. Use a sharp knife to carefully slice the muffin in half. This will help it defrost more quickly and evenly.
3. Place the muffin halves in the toaster or toaster oven. If you don’t have a toaster, you can also use a regular oven set to 350 degrees Fahrenheit.
4. Toast the muffin halves for 1-2 minutes, or until they are warm and crispy.
5. Remove the muffin halves from the toaster or oven and let them cool for a minute or two.
6. Once the muffin halves are cool enough to handle, you can add your favorite toppings and enjoy!
Tips and Tricks
Here are a few tips and tricks to help you defrost English muffins like a pro:
– If you’re in a hurry, you can defrost the muffin halves in the microwave. Simply place them on a microwave-safe plate and heat them on high for 30 seconds to 1 minute, or until they are warm and soft.
– To prevent the muffin halves from getting soggy, be sure to let them cool for a minute or two before adding any toppings.
– If you have leftover English muffins that you don’t want to freeze, you can store them in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days.
